#interview_list {
	padding-bottom:150px;
}
@media screen and (max-width: 768px) { 
	#interview_list {
		padding-bottom:88px;
	}
}

/* 인터뷰 리스트 타이틀 */
#interview_list h3.title {
	padding:120px 0 50px;
	font-size:34px;
	font-weight:900;
}
@media screen and (max-width: 1024px) { 
	#interview_list h3.title {
		padding:80px 0 35px;
		font-size:28px;
	}
}
@media screen and (max-width: 768px) { 
	#interview_list h3.title {
		padding:40px 0 25px;
		font-size:24px;
	}
}

/* 인터뷰 리스트 */
#interview_list .list {
	margin-left:-30px;
	font-size:0;
}
#interview_list .list > li {
	display:inline-block;
	width:33.33%;
	padding-left:30px;
	margin-bottom:50px;
	vertical-align:top;
}
#interview_list .list > li > a {
	display:block;
}
#interview_list .list > li > a .img {
	overflow:hidden;
	border:2px solid #fff;
}
#interview_list .list > li > a .img img {
	width:100%;
	transition:all .3s ease;
}
#interview_list .list > li > a:hover .img {
	border-color:#f86e1a;
}
#interview_list .list > li > a:hover .img img {
	-ms-transform: scale(1.05,1.05);
	-webkit-transform: scale(1.05,1.05);
	transform: scale(1.05,1.05);
}
#interview_list .list > li > a .info {
	padding-top:18px;
}
#interview_list .list > li > a .info .cate {
	color:#f86e1a;
	font-size:16px;
}
#interview_list .list > li > a .info .subject {
	overflow: hidden;
	margin-top:12px;
	font-size:20px;
	font-weight:700;
	white-space: nowrap;
	text-overflow: ellipsis;
}
#interview_list .list > li > a .info .name {
	margin-top:8px;
	color:#808080;
	font-size:16px;
}
@media screen and (max-width: 1024px) { 
	#interview_list .list > li {
		width:50%;
	}
}
@media screen and (max-width: 768px) { 
	#interview_list .list {
		margin-left:0;
	}
	#interview_list .list > li {
		width:100%;
		padding-left:0;
		margin-bottom:45px;
	}
}

/* 인터뷰 리스트 */
#interview_list .paging {
	display:flex;
	justify-content:center;
	padding-top:30px;
}
#interview_list .paging > li {
	padding:0 9px;
}
#interview_list .paging > li.prev {
	padding-right:15px;
}
#interview_list .paging > li.next {
	padding-left:15px;
}
#interview_list .paging > li a,
#interview_list .paging > li strong {
	display:flex;
	align-items:center; 
	justify-content:space-around; 
	width:26px; 
	height:26px;
	background:#fff; 
	color:#808080; 
	font-size:14px;
	font-weight:300;
	transition:all .3s ease-in-out;
}
#interview_list .paging > li strong {
	background:#fbf8f1;
	color:#f86e1a;
	font-weight:400;
}
#interview_list .paging > li a img {
	width:20px;
}
#interview_list .paging > li a:hover {
	background:#fbf8f1;
}
@media screen and (max-width: 768px) { 
	#interview_list .paging {
		padding-top:15px;
	}
}